This perennial hosta is proof that hostas are far from boring. Rainbow's End Hosta has glossy green leaves with large patches of bright yellow to white variations. It will produce spikes of dark lavender flowers in late summer. Hostas are primarily grown for their long-lasting foliage. Plant this short perennial in partial to full shade conditions in USDA hardiness zones 3 through 9. The leaves will grow to be 11 inches tall with 16-to-19-inch flower stems.

Rainbow's End Hosta spreads up to 21 inches wide in a mounded habit. This makes it a good choice for the filler role in pots. It’s also a lovely choice to plant along walkways, in between shrubs, and toward the front of border gardens. Hummingbirds are attracted to the scalloped bell-shaped flowers.

Rainbow's End Hosta Care

This easy to care for plant will grow in almost any average to fertile soil. It has average watering requirements but prefers moist, organic soils. Apply a balanced, slow-release fertilizer after panting and when new growth emerges in the spring. Use mulch to help retain soil moisture.

Some gardeners remove the flowers to encourage more foliage growth, but this is not necessary. The leaves will turn a pretty yellow faded to tan in the fall. In late fall, they’ll flatten on the ground and become mushy. Cut them back to discourage slugs and disease. You can also wait until spring to cut them back.

Rainbow's End Hosta Spacing

Space plants 21 inches apart to give them room to spread and wow you and your garden visitors with their unique foliage pattern.
